>For instance, by default, anyone that can reliably man-in-the-middle port 80 on your website can get an acme certificate for your domain from a reputable certificate authority.

You are leaving out a huge caveat here - exactly where the MITM is taking place matters a lot. In 99% cases this isn't possible unless the victim server network is effectively compromised.
